Paper Bird Philanthropy
/0 Comments/in News/by Jen JacksonIn 2020 Paper Bird is dedicating 5% of all industry sales (teachers, librarians, SCBWI & CBCA members who receive 10% discount on their purchases) to the Paper Bird Fund that supports our community service programs including Woylie Project, Paper Bird Fellowship and Story Lab.
